Understanding Corrugated Dual Wall Pipe
Corrugated dual wall pipes consist of two layers an inner smooth wall and an outer corrugated wall. The smooth inner layer facilitates the easy flow of fluids, while the corrugated outer layer provides strength and resistance to external pressures. This dual-wall design effectively combines the advantages of both smooth and corrugated pipes, resulting in exceptional performance characteristics.
Advantages of Corrugated Dual Wall Pipe
1. Enhanced Strength and Durability
One of the most significant benefits of corrugated dual wall pipes is their enhanced strength. The corrugated outer layer provides structural integrity, allowing the pipe to withstand high pressure and heavy loads without deforming. This makes it particularly suitable for underground applications where soil and water pressure can be significant. The durability of these pipes ensures a long lifespan, reducing the need for frequent replacements and maintenance.
2. Lightweight and Easy to Install
Despite their strength, corrugated dual wall pipes are relatively lightweight compared to traditional concrete or metal piping systems. This characteristic simplifies transportation and handling during installation, resulting in lower labor costs and reduced project timelines. Furthermore, the flexible nature of these pipes allows them to be easily maneuvered and fitted into various applications without the need for extensive excavation.

4. Effective Flow Management
The inner smooth wall of corrugated dual wall pipes offers superior flow characteristics. The smooth surface minimizes friction, allowing for the efficient transport of liquids, whether they are stormwater, wastewater, or chemical substances. This property is particularly crucial in applications where flow rate management is vital, such as in drainage systems where rapid water removal is necessary to prevent flooding.
